特别是在云计算技术飞速发展,企业对IT基础设施依赖程度日益加深的背景下,如何高效、简洁地监控服务器状态,及时发现并解决问题,成为了众多开发者和系统管理员共同面对的挑战
而Linux Dash API,正是这样一款能够满足这些需求的强大工具
Linux Dash API概述 Linux Dash是一款专为Linux服务器设计的轻量级监控工具,它利用基于Web的界面,提供了服务器运行状态的全面视图
从内存使用情况到磁盘空间占用,再到网络状态,Linux Dash都能以直观的方式展示给用户,使得无论是系统管理员还是开发者,都能轻松掌握服务器的健康状况
Linux Dash的核心优势在于其强大的数据展示能力和简洁易用的界面设计
它不仅能够实时监测并显示内存使用情况,帮助识别潜在的内存泄漏问题,还能清晰地呈现出各个分区的磁盘空间使用率,避免因存储空间不足而导致的服务中断
此外,网络状态的监控也是其一大亮点,无论是带宽使用情况还是连接数统计,都能通过直观的图表形式呈现出来,使管理员能够快速定位网络层面的问题
Linux Dash API的安装与配置 在开始使用Linux Dash API之前,首先需要确保服务器环境满足其基本要求
Linux Dash支持多种Linux发行版,如Ubuntu、CentOS或Fedora等
同时,服务器上需要安装必要的软件包,如curl和git,用于下载和配置Linux Dash
此外,由于Linux Dash是一个基于Web的应用,因此还需要确保服务器上已安装并运行着web服务器(如Nginx或Apache)以及Node.js环境
安装Linux Dash的过程相对直接,但每一步骤都需谨慎操作
首先,使用git clone命令从GitHub下载Linux Dash的源代码至服务器
接下来,进入项目目录并通过运行npm install命令来安装所有必需的依赖项
一旦准备就绪,即可通过执行npm start命令启动Linux Dash应用程序
此时,如果一切顺利,你应该能在服务器的本地地址(例如http://localhost:8080)看到Linux Dash的欢迎页面
在生产环境中部署时,建议使用如forever或pm2这样的进程管理器来确保Linux Dash应用程序始终处于运行状态
此外,深入理解Linux Dash的配置选项对于充分发挥其潜力至关重要
配置文件通常位于项目的根目录下,名为config.json
通过编辑此文件,用户可以自定义监听端口、日志级别以及各种监控指标的开启或关闭状态,以满足自身实际需求
Linux Dash API的功能与特点 Linux Dash API提供了丰富的功能,以满足不同用户的监控与管理需求
以下是一些主要功能和特点: 1.实时数据监控:Linux Dash能够实时监测服务器的内存使用情况、磁盘空间占用、网络状态等关键指标,并通过直观的图表形式呈现出来
这使得管理员能够一目了然地掌握服务器的健康状况,及时发现并解决问题
2.多模块设计:Linux Dash的界面设计简洁明了,包含了系统信息、内存使用、磁盘空间、网
Linux SSH:轻松实现远程文件Copy技巧
掌握Linux Dash API:高效管理Linux系统的秘诀
PCIe SSD在Linux系统下的性能优化
hyper年少有为:青春不负韶华梦
Navicat 1045错误在Linux上的解决方案
Linux GTKmm开发入门指南
Hyper UB:未来科技生活的超速引擎
Linux SSH:轻松实现远程文件Copy技巧
PCIe SSD在Linux系统下的性能优化
Linux GTKmm开发入门指南
Navicat 1045错误在Linux上的解决方案
Linux开发必备:详解`mknod`命令创建设备文件
Linux Swap空间:优化内存管理的秘密武器
Xshell6实战:掌握shutdown命令技巧
Linux服务器HTTPD配置301重定向全攻略
Linux管道命令:高效数据处理秘籍
Linux获取时间戳的实用技巧
Linux系统下关闭Oracle启动流程
Linux网桥深度解析:构建高效网络桥接的必备指南